The 6 x 50ml Indigenous Collection Face and Body Paints is a unique set inspired by traditional Indigenous art and cultural practices. These paints are perfect for creating meaningful designs and patterns for cultural celebrations, performances, or artistic expressions. With deep, earthy tones and vibrant natural colors, this collection brings authenticity and respect to Indigenous body art traditions.

Key Features:

  • 6 Authentic Colors: The Indigenous Collection includes six specially selected colors often associated with traditional Indigenous art and body painting. These colors typically include earthy tones such as ochre, red, brown, white, black, and yellow, reflecting the natural pigments used in Indigenous cultures around the world.
  • 50ml Tubes: Each paint comes in a 50ml tube, providing plenty of product for multiple applications. This size is perfect for detailed face painting, body art, or large-scale designs, ensuring you have enough paint for extended use.
  • Inspired by Indigenous Traditions: The color palette in this collection is inspired by the natural pigments used by Indigenous cultures for ceremonial and artistic purposes. These paints honor the rich history of body painting in Indigenous communities, making them ideal for cultural events, education, and creative exploration.
  • Skin-Safe and Non-toxic: These paints are formulated with non-toxic, skin-friendly ingredients, ensuring they are safe for use on both the face and body. They are suitable for all ages and can be used in a variety of settings, including cultural performances, school events, or community gatherings.
  • Easy Application and Removal: With a smooth, creamy consistency, these paints are easy to apply using brushes, sponges, or fingers. Once the event or activity is over, they can be easily removed with soap and water, making them convenient for any occasion.
